My wife and I were in town for several days for a couple Spring Training baseball games. This property is an ideal location not just for its proximity to LECOM Park (a 10-minute walk), but also for several restaurants and bars that are nearby (Motorworks Brewing is only a couple of short blocks away). An added bonus, the property is located within the Village of the Arts, a small, quaint neighborhood that features some beautifully-painted buildings/residences. There are also some excellent galleries to visit nearby (one of which, Joan Peters Gallery, is just two doors away) as well as a record store that is around the corner (Jerk Dog Records), which happens to be right across the street from a fantastic soul food restaurant (Cottonmouth Southern Soul Food).
